queren

to cross

To cross something from one side to the other, usually referring to a street, a square, or a body of water.

example

Wir müssen die Hauptstraße queren, um zum Supermarkt zu gelangen.

We have to cross the main road to get to the supermarket.

queren vs passieren

to happen / pass

'passieren' and 'queren' can both have to do with movement at a place. 'passieren' is used when you pass by a place or leave a border, checkpoint, or specific point behind you. 'queren' means more precisely that you cross something from one side to the other, for example a street, a square, or a river. They can be confused because both describe movement across or at a place. If the direction from one side to the other is important, 'queren' fits better.
